The Full Scoop on Grand Hotel Mania 5th Anniversary
Grand Hotel Mania is pulling out all the stops for its 5th anniversary celebration. One of the standout additions is the introduction of Premium Hotels, allowing players to manage ultra-luxurious establishments. Keep an eye out for the new tab on your game map to access these high-end properties.
These premium hotels are exclusive havens waiting for your management skills. To unlock them, you can collect keys through various in-game activities or take advantage of special offers that come with additional bonuses.
The crown jewel of the Premium lineup is none other than Claridge’s in London. Step into the role of Monica and Ted, your seasoned hotel managers, as you oversee check-ins, check-outs, and prepare gourmet dishes such as Natural Fruit Juice, Salmon Tartare, Shrimp Cocktail, and Lemonade with Ice. It's a culinary delight!
Another exciting feature is the new hotel map, which showcases all the hotels in your collection and those yet to be unlocked. Simply tap the map to preview the future hotels you can add to your empire as you progress through the levels.
Have You Managed Any Hotel(Game)s Yet?
If you're new to Grand Hotel Mania: Hotel Games, let's give you a quick overview. This time-management game places you in the role of a premier hotel manager where you'll make crucial decisions, manage resources, and expand your hotel empire. The game also includes features like merging, expeditions, isometric maps, and the dynamic duo of Monica and Ted.
